Note that you can avoid these questions by passing the '-n' option to 'Makefile.PL'. Run Heap::Simple benchmarks during 'make test' ? [n] n Use of uninitialized value in string ne at /home/cpanrun/pa-risc1.1/build/5.6.1/lib/5.6.1/ExtUtils/MakeMaker.pm line 141. Checking if your kit is complete... Looks good Writing Makefile for Heap::Simple::Perl cp lib/Heap/Simple/Function.pm blib/lib/Heap/Simple/Function.pm cp lib/Heap/Simple/Hash.pm blib/lib/Heap/Simple/Hash.pm cp lib/Heap/Simple/Less.pm blib/lib/Heap/Simple/Less.pm cp lib/Heap/Simple/Number.pm blib/lib/Heap/Simple/Number.pm cp lib/Heap/Simple/Scalar.pm blib/lib/Heap/Simple/Scalar.pm cp lib/Heap/Simple/StringReverse.pm blib/lib/Heap/Simple/StringReverse.pm cp lib/Heap/Simple/Wrapper.pm blib/lib/Heap/Simple/Wrapper.pm cp lib/Heap/Simple/Any.pm blib/lib/Heap/Simple/Any.pm cp lib/Heap/Simple/String.pm blib/lib/Heap/Simple/String.pm cp lib/Heap/Simple/Method.pm blib/lib/Heap/Simple/Method.pm cp lib/Heap/Simple/Object.pm blib/lib/Heap/Simple/Object.pm cp lib/Heap/Simple/Perl.pm blib/lib/Heap/Simple/Perl.pm AutoSplitting blib/lib/Heap/Simple/Perl.pm (blib/lib/auto/Heap/Simple/Perl) blib/lib/Heap/Simple/Perl.pm: some names are not unique when truncated to 8 characters: directory blib/lib/auto/Heap/Simple/Perl: extract_upto.al, extract_top.al, extract_min.al, extract_first.al truncate to extract_ cp lib/Heap/Simple/NumberReverse.pm blib/lib/Heap/Simple/NumberReverse.pm cp lib/Heap/Simple/Array.pm blib/lib/Heap/Simple/Array.pm Manifying blib/man3/Heap::Simple::Perl.3 PERL_DL_NONLAZY=1 /home/cpanrun/pa-risc1.1/build/5.6.1/bin/perl -Iblib/arch -Iblib/lib -I/home/cpanrun/pa-risc1.1/build/5.6.1/lib/5.6.1/PA-RISC1.1-thread-multi -I/home/cpanrun/pa-risc1.1/build/5.6.1/lib/5.6.1 -e 'use Test::Harness qw(&runtests $verbose); $verbose=1; runtests @ARGV;' t/*.t t/00_load........1..1 ok 1 - use Heap::Simple::Perl; ok t/01_basic.......ok 1 - use Heap::Simple; ok 2 - We get the type we asked for isa Heap::Simple ok 3 - And it's also of the expected implementor type isa Heap::Simple::Perl ok 4 ok 5 ok 6 ok 7 ok 8 ok 9 ok 10 ok 11 ok 12 ok 13 ok 14 ok 15 - extract on empty fails ok 16 - extract on empty fails ok 17 ok 18 ok 19 ok 20 ok 21 ok 22 ok 23 ok 24 ok 25 ok 26 ok 27 ok 28 ok 29 ok 30 ok 31 ok 32 ok 33 ok 34 ok 35 ok 36 Use of inherited AUTOLOAD for non-method Heap::Simple::Auto::Number::Scalar::_KEY() is deprecated at (eval 17) line 24. Can't locate auto/Heap/Simple/Auto/Number/Scalar/_KEY.al in @INC (@INC contains: t blib/arch blib/lib /home/cpanrun/pa-risc1.1/build/5.6.1/lib/5.6.1/PA-RISC1.1-thread-multi /home/cpanrun/pa-risc1.1/build/5.6.1/lib/5.6.1 /home/cpanrun/pa-risc1.1/build/5.6.1/lib/site_perl/5.6.1/PA-RISC1.1-thread-multi /home/cpanrun/pa-risc1.1/build/5.6.1/lib/site_perl/5.6.1 /home/cpanrun/pa-risc1.1/build/5.6.1/lib/site_perl .) at (eval 17) line 24 1..36 # Looks like your test died just after 36. dubious Test returned status 255 (wstat 65280, 0xff00) after all the subtests completed successfully t/02_stress......ok 1 - use Heap::Simple; ok 2 - Succesfully installed function ok 3 - Nothing yet ok 4 - Proper error message: 'Unknown option 'foo' at t/02_stress.t line 63 # ' ok 5 - Proper error message: 'Odd number of elements in options at t/02_stress.t line 66 # ' ok 6 - Proper error message: 'Unknown order 'zap' at t/02_stress.t line 69 # ' ok 7 - Proper error message: 'Can't locate Heap/Simple/Zap.pm in @INC (@INC contains: t blib/arch blib/lib /home/cpanrun/pa-risc1.1/build/5.6.1/lib/5.6.1/PA-RISC1.1-thread-multi /home/cpanrun/pa-risc1.1/build/5.6.1/lib/5.6.1 /home/cpanrun/pa-risc1.1/build/5.6.1/lib/site_perl/5.6.1/PA-RISC1.1-thread-multi /home/cpanrun/pa-risc1.1/build/5.6.1/lib/site_perl/5.6.1 /home/cpanrun/pa-risc1.1/build/5.6.1/lib/site_perl .) at blib/lib/Heap/Simple/Perl.pm line 18. # ' ok 8 - Proper error message: 'max_count should not be negative at t/02_stress.t line 78 # ' ok 9 - Proper error message: 'max_count should be an integer at t/02_stress.t line 83 # ' ok 10 ok 11 Use of inherited AUTOLOAD for non-method Heap::Simple::Auto::Number::Scalar::_KEY() is deprecated at (eval 20) line 15. Can't locate auto/Heap/Simple/Auto/Number/Scalar/_KEY.al in @INC (@INC contains: t blib/arch blib/lib /home/cpanrun/pa-risc1.1/build/5.6.1/lib/5.6.1/PA-RISC1.1-thread-multi /home/cpanrun/pa-risc1.1/build/5.6.1/lib/5.6.1 /home/cpanrun/pa-risc1.1/build/5.6.1/lib/site_perl/5.6.1/PA-RISC1.1-thread-multi /home/cpanrun/pa-risc1.1/build/5.6.1/lib/site_perl/5.6.1 /home/cpanrun/pa-risc1.1/build/5.6.1/lib/site_perl .) at (eval 20) line 15 # Looks like your test died just after 11. 1..11 dubious Test returned status 255 (wstat 65280, 0xff00) after all the subtests completed successfully t/03_magic.......ok 1 - use Heap::Simple; ok 2 - 1 fetch for the class, 14 fetches for the options, 2 fetches for the elements plus 3 extra because we didn't make a copy ok 3 - Magic options access ok 4 - Deep magic options access ok 5 ok 6 ok 7 ok 8 ok 9 ok 10 ok 11 ok 12 ok 13 ok 14 ok 15 ok 16 ok 17 ok 18 ok 19 ok 20 ok 21 ok 22 ok 23 ok 24 - Access the key even for empty insert ok 25 - Immediately activate magic ok 26 ok 27 - No double activation ok 28 ok 29 ok 30 ok 31 ok 32 ok 33 ok 34 ok 35 - Key fetch even on empty heap ok 36 ok 37 ok 38 ok 39 ok 40 ok 41 ok 42 ok 43 ok 44 ok 45 ok 46 ok 47 1..47 ok t/04_overload....ok 1 - use Heap::Simple; ok 2 ok 3 ok 4 ok 5 1..5 ok t/99_speed.......1..2 ok 1 # skip No benchmark requested ok 2 # skip No benchmark requested ok 2/2 skipped: No benchmark requested Failed 2/6 test scripts, 66.67% okay. 0/102 subtests failed, 100.00% okay. Failed Test Stat Wstat Total Fail Failed List of Failed ----------------------------------------------------------------------------------------------------------------------------------------------------------------------------- t/01_basic.t 255 65280 36 0 0.00% ?? t/02_stress.t 255 65280 11 0 0.00% ?? 2 subtests skipped. make: *** [test_dynamic] Error 11